EDA365电子论坛网

标题: 改 SCF 文件,把堆栈的值设置大了一些,出问题了 [打印本页]

作者: Dollche    时间: 2022-12-28 10:40
标题: 改 SCF 文件,把堆栈的值设置大了一些,出问题了
我改了以下 SCF 文件,把堆栈的值设置大了一些,但是还是出现以前的老问题,那就是程序跑到TargetResetInit()函数处后就跳到取数据终止的异常中断去了.
  ~+ T/ S. {5 {# ^# }3 X; n
作者: 风吹过后    时间: 2022-12-28 13:19
不能把堆栈设置到内部 RAM 之外。
作者: big_gun    时间: 2022-12-28 14:07
".scf"文件中的"+RW"对应".s"源文件中的"READWRITE".
1 [8 @- A1 C* Y".scf"文件中的"+ZI"对应".s"源文件中的"NOINIT".
6 g( o3 s3 }# r".scf"文件中的"+RO"对应".s"源文件中的"READONLY".
作者: 名字好听吗    时间: 2022-12-28 14:11
scf文件,全名scatter file,中文名分散加载文件,是ARMlink的输入参数,如果你想把你的代码固定的放在存储器的某个特定的位置,用scf文件就特别方便。




欢迎光临 EDA365电子论坛网 (https://bbs.eda365.com/) Powered by Discuz! X3.2